Won't ride without them! Nov 05, 2010
By G.L. Started wearing them as a new rider because.. well you all know why. Now I won't ride short or long rides without them. They are light, wick moisture very well and add just enough extra padding that even after a century ride I'm ready to get back on... the next day! The fit is also pretty good although since I am 5'7" they are a bit too long. But the sizing is good on the waist.

Light & Flexible May 12, 2011
By Richard Lemmon I found these to be a very comfortable fit. I went by the suggested chart when ordering my size and found it to be accurate. The leg bands fit well but are not too snug. They also don't creep up your leg. The only reason I didn't give a 5 star was due to the waste band. It is thin and feels a bit flimsy. I wish it had a thicker band like on boxer shorts.

Not worth half the price! Jul 24, 2012
By Matthew Wood I bought these in hopes of finding a good quality padded short to wear under my regular shorts when I go out to ride. Unfortunately, I didn't get that with this product.
The shorts got here rather quickly...no issues with the sender or shipper. They did their job well.
When I pulled the shorts out of the box, my immediate thought was that someone sent me grannie's stockings. The quality of the product was low...like someone just took a pair of control top panty hose and stuck some padding in the crotch. I decided to keep an open mind and give them a couple of shots...maybe I would be pleasantly surprised. I tried them on for the first time. The fit, and the padding, was less than impressive. I went out to bike around 20-25 miles on descent pavement (no off-roading), and came home just as sore as if I had no padding. I gave them a second try just yesterday (in case the first was just an off day), and had the same experience. I have a pair of padded shorts made by another company (not on Amazon, sold at REI) that are a few dollars more, however, provide a much better fit and feel...I'm sticking with those!

Disappointed Jun 12, 2012
By Jescpen I am an avid cyclist. I weigh about 155lbs and ride 4 to 5 days a week & 150 to 200 miles. It's very hot here (near Wichita Falls, Texas) so comfort is definitely a priority. I ordered these biking undershorts to give me a little extra padding under my regular biking shorts for that 4th or 5th consecutive day when the ol' tailbone is beginning to really get sore. Most of the reviews I read were positive so I went for it. The fit was good, with no 'rolling' of the waistband, but I am disappointed in crotch comfort. The material holding the padding in place is the same as the rest of the shorts(nylon/lycra) and from the getgo felt like I was sitting on sand paper. I did a short '30 miler' yesterday and wasn't sure I'd make it back, my crotch was in such pain. Guess I'll try wearing 2 pair of light-weight biking shorts with the chamois crotch.
P.S. I re-read the reviews of this undershort and one of them mentioned that they like the chamois crotch liner. NOTE: This undershort does NOT have a chamois crotch liner!
